About Smita S. Kumar
Smita S. Kumar is a scholar working on Environmental Engineering,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Biomedical Engineering,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ment and Pollution, having authored 79 papers that have together received 5.9k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Microbial Fuel Cells and Bioremediation (18 papers), Electrochemical sensors and biosensors (13 papers), Algal biology and biofuel production (12 papers), Anaerobic Digestion and Biogas Production (10 papers), Biodiesel Production and Applications (6 papers), Electrochemical Analysis and Applications (6 papers), Nanoparticles: synthesis and applications (6 papers) and Metal-Organic Frameworks: Synthesis and Applications (5 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Pollution (1.1k citations), Environmental Engineering (901 citations), Industrial and Manufacturing Engineering (516 citations),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ment (968 citations) and Water Science and Technology (810 citations). Smita S. Kumar has collaborated with scholars based in India, Vietnam and Israel. Frequent co-authors include Arivalagan Pugazhendhi, Sandeep K. Malyan, Vivek Kumar, Narsi R. Bishnoi, Thangavel Mathimani, Amit Kumar, Pooja Ghosh, Jyoti Sharma, Dipak Kumar Gupta and Lakhveer Singh. Their work appears in journals such as Chemosphere, Bioresource Technology, Fuel, Biocatalysis and Agricultural Biotechnology and Journal of Photochemistry and Photobiology B Biology.
